The Tragedy of Fort Binġemma

Fort Binġemma is a British fortification completed in 1878, forming part of the Victoria Lines defence system stretching from Rabat to Pembroke. It is a national heritage - currently occupied by squatters. The Fort Binġemma Complex - Image Composite from a video dated Jan 2021 by Joe Grange In 1981 the fort was leased by the Dom Mintoff Labour Government of the time to Gaetano ‘Gejtu’ Buttigieg for use as a farm. The lease occurred shortly before the infamous 1981 general election . Fort Binġemma was leased to Gaetano Buttigieg in 1981 – Image Source: Steve Buttigieg Such land leases were not uncommon at the time, with various historical sites sold or leased off as farms for a pittance. Examples include Fort Leonardo and Fort Bengħajsa . If the latter fort’s lease is any indication, the cost was around €200 yearly. Adjusted for inflation this would be around €600/yr.
